Client made contribution to an IRA and converted it to a Roth.  He received a 1099R for the distribution code 2.

I don't know how to get it to flow properly in the return.

You enter the 1099-R, show it was completely rolled over, and you need to enter Basis, so that it is computed as taxable or not. The conversion is entered for the calendar year of the conversion, not the contribution tax year.
